// Fixture: simulates the Tarnfield load balancer probing three backend
// replicas on /healthz. One replica deliberately returns 503 to verify
// that the balancer drains it without dropping in-flight requests.
// Probes against the mock control plane must be authenticated, matching
// production behavior. The fixture signs each probe with the bearer
// token defined below.

portal login ticket: eyJhbGciOiJIUzI1NiIsInR5cCI6IkpXVCJ9.eyJzdWIiOiIwEOsktwVNwIn0.-UJU3fdyyCgG

Handover note — Crumbwheel order cutoffs.

Welcome aboard. The bakery cutoff rule in Crumbwheel closes same-day orders at 14:00 local to each storefront, not UTC — this has bitten us twice. Holiday overrides live in the calendar service and take precedence silently, so always check there first when a cutoff looks wrong. To unlock the calendar service's admin console after a restart, enter the recovery passphrase below.

vault phrase of bagap-bahaf = silion-pelox-sorox-casdor-quenwyn-fraax-eliox-praael-kelion-quenvan-kasox-rusael-norius-belvan

For the incoming director.

Current policy: deals above threshold require VP sign-off; max discount 18%. Problem: approvals slow, reps game the threshold by splitting orders. Proposal from the Varnell account review: raise auto-approval ceiling, cap discounts at 15%, add quarterly audit. Finance supports; Sales Ops wants a pilot with the Orchard Line team first. Decision needed before kickoff. Margin targets assume no change until pilot results land. The commercial reasoning driving this shift is recorded below.

board note of bawep-tajef: Queniusek Systems plans to raise the Quenvan list price by 53.1 percent in March. The pricing group signed off on a budget of $176.4 million for Project Drueth. The renewal with Casionix Partners closes at $142.5 million a year, 8.3 percent below the last contract. Project Fraax slips by six weeks because of the tooling delay.

Key ceremony checklist, item 7: Crashlane pipeline signing key rotation. Confirm both custodians from the Orvatine team are present and the old key for the mobile crash-report ingest has been revoked in the Crashlane console. Generate the new signing key on the air-gapped laptop, verify the fingerprint aloud, and seal the backup shard in the ceremony envelope. Before sealing, record the envelope's recovery passphrase in the log; it appears directly below this line.

strongbox words: fraath-isteth